Care

A fabric sofa is a wonderful choice for those with kids and animals, as it's often more long lasting than leather options. However, it does require extra factor to consider in terms of cleansing and maintenance. Make sure to follow the manufacturer's care guide for your particular fabric, and also watch out for any stain elimination kits that may come with it-- these are a great method to guarantee you have all of the tools needed to rapidly and successfully handle daily spillages, marks and discolorations.

A light vacuum and brush off ought to be part of your everyday regimen for your sofa, to assist get rid of dirt and particles that can embed into the fibers and cause micro-tears. Constantly make sure to utilize a lint roller on the cushions too, which can help avoid the colour of your sofa from dulling gradually. A weekly fluffing of your cushions will also assist them maintain their shape, and if they are filled with a natural fiber, such as feathers or down, regularly changing the filling will assist longevity.

In case of any spillages, ensure you act rapidly-- a damp fabric ought to be used to blot any liquids instead of rub them. This will help to remove the stain before it sets into the fabric and can end up being harder to remove. It is also worth noting that specific materials require different cleaning options, so if you are using homemade cleaners, it's finest to test these on a little location of your fabric sofa before applying to the whole surface.

It's also important to guarantee your sofa is put on even floor covering, as dragging and tugging can put unneeded tension onto the frame and fabric of your sofa. Think about putting protective flooring pads on the bottom of your furnishings legs, which will help reduce scratches on wood floorings. It's an excellent idea to raise your sofa when you require to move it too, instead of dragging it-- this will help to avoid damage to the frame and fabric, and can also lessen the possibility of any accidental rips or tears in the upholstery.
